Console from Sony.
Technical specs
CPU: | MIPS R3051, 33.8688 MHz (32bit RISC, R3000A-compatible) |
GPU: |
|
Memory: |
|
Sound: | Can handle ADPCM sources with up to 24 channels and up to 44.1 kHz sampling rate |
Media: | CD-ROM (2X) |
Connectors
- 2 x Sony Playstation Controller Port
- 2 x proprietary Memory Card slots using MagicGate encryption
- 1 x Audio/Video Port
- 1 x Serial Link Port
- 1 x Parallel Bus for expantion (Cheat Modules, that is).
